Issues fixed
- If you haven't found a fix, check our DOSBox page for solutions.
Error when starting the game
- If an error doesn't let you into the game change the DOSBox output mode to something else.
The game is too slow/fast
- Just press Ctrl+F11 to slow down or Ctrl+F12 to speed up in DOSBox.
